3 Factors That Affect the Cost of 5083 Aluminium Alloy

The cost of 5083 aluminium alloy is influenced by various factors that play a crucial role in determining its market price. Understanding these factors is essential for businesses and individuals involved in the procurement of this specific alloy. Here are three key factors that significantly affect the cost of 5083 aluminium alloy:

Aluminium Market Prices:

The overall market prices of aluminium, which are subject to global supply and demand dynamics, have a direct impact on the cost of 5083 aluminium alloy. Fluctuations in the aluminium market, driven by factors such as geopolitical events, economic conditions, and industry trends, can influence the raw material costs for producing 5083 aluminium.

Alloy Specifications and Purity:

The specific requirements and purity of the 5083 aluminium alloy can affect its cost. Different alloy specifications may involve additional processing steps or the addition of specific elements to enhance the alloy's properties, and these variations can contribute to cost differences. Higher purity levels or alloy modifications for specific applications may result in an increase in production costs, influencing the overall cost of the alloy.

Processing and Fabrication Costs:

The processes involved in manufacturing and fabricating 5083 aluminium alloy also contribute to its final cost. This includes the extraction of raw materials, alloying, casting, rolling or extrusion, heat treatment, and any additional treatments or surface finishes. The complexity of these processes, as well as the technology and equipment used, can impact production costs and, consequently, the cost of the final product.

It's important to note that these factors are interconnected, and changes in one factor can have a cascading effect on the overall cost of 5083 aluminium alloy. Additionally, the quality and reputation of the supplier, as well as regional factors, may also play a role in determining the final cost.
